Lambert-Eaton syndrome is an antibody-mediated neuromuscular junction disorder. This disorder, which is most frequently encountered in patients with small-cell lung carcinoma, is characterized clinically by weakness and hyporeflexia. The impaired release of acetylcholine vesicles from presynaptic terminals at neuromuscular junctions that causes the weakness is a consequence of autoantibodies against small cell carcinoma epitopes that cross-react with and downregulate the expression of motor nerve terminal Ca2+ channels [39]. The synovial arrays were incubated with the sera from patients with early and severe RA as well as healthy patients. Hierarchical clustering analysis revealed that autoreactive B-cell responses for citrullinated epitopes were present in a subset of patients with early RA, features which are predictive of the development of severe RA. In contrast, autoantibodies directed against native epitopes including several human cartilage gp39 peptides and type II collagen, were associated with features predictive of less severe RA. [Pg.207]
